From fac5493251a680cb74343895d0e76843624a90d8 Mon Sep 17 00:00:00 2001 From: Nam Cao Date: Wed, 9 Jul 2025 21:21:23 +0200 Subject: [PATCH] rv: Allow to configure the number of per-task monitor Now that there are 2 monitors for real-time applications, users may want to enable both of them simultaneously. Make the number of per-task monitor configurable. Default it to 2 for now.
